Rajkot, April 10 (NationPress) As the Pradhan Mantri Mudra Yojana (PMMY) marks its tenth anniversary since its inception on April 8, 2015, numerous success stories have emerged, particularly among the middle class, who not only envisioned their own businesses but also brought them to fruition with the financial support provided by the government.
Beneficiaries of the Mudra Yojana, especially from the middle and lower middle classes across India, express their gratitude towards the government for enabling funding for their entrepreneurial endeavors.
In Rajkot, Gujarat, several beneficiaries shared their experiences with IANS, highlighting how the Mudra Yojana was pivotal in transforming their lives.

This beneficiary operates his business in Gokul Nagar, situated on the ring road in Rajkot. In 2018, he aspired to launch a startup but lacked the necessary funds. Upon learning about the PM Mudra Yojana, he approached the bank, secured a loan, and successfully expanded his business.
Importantly, the PMMY provides easy, collateral-free loans of up to Rs 10 lakh for non-corporate and non-farm income-generating activities. These loans are made available to aspiring entrepreneurs through banks, non-banking financial companies, and various financial institutions.
Countless small business owners nationwide have availed themselves of loans under this scheme, consequently expanding their businesses and creating job opportunities for others.
